Test plan: Lanternpipe canary gating

New team members: every canary release must pass three gates before ramp-up — error rate under 0.5% for 30 minutes, p99 latency within 10% of baseline, and zero failed health probes. The gate-check job runs automatically, but manual verification against the gating API is required for hotfixes. That API authenticates with the bearer token shown below.

portal login ticket: eyJhbGciOiJIUzI1NiIsInR5cCI6IkpXVCJ9.eyJzdWIiOiI8fpAIDIn0.2HWsKY39

Handover: cron drift on Lanternjar schedulers

Handing this to Priya Okonn. Symptom: nightly exports on Lanternjar fire 3–7 minutes late, worse after host reboots. NTP sync looks fine; suspect the leader-election delay in the Tollgate scheduler pool. Mitigation in place: exports re-run automatically if late by >10 min, so no customer action needed. Do not restart schedulers manually. Full timeline, affected tenants, and current hypotheses are tracked on the internal page below.

wiki page, fahaf-yagag: https://confluence.qorvellabs.internal/pages/display/pages/display

## Env vars: CharsetScout

For this week's sync: CharsetScout now detects encoding on uploaded text files before ingestion. `CS_FALLBACK` sets the default when confidence is low; `CS_SAMPLE_BYTES` controls scan depth. Detection results are cached per upload. The service also verifies upload signatures, so the env file must include the verification secret on the line below:

sealed setting: ARCHIVE_KEY3=8d0

Hi Marta — the Skylark V2 drone from the Bryndale survey team came back this morning for servicing. Rotors three and four are wobbling and the gimbal mount looks cracked, so flag it for a full inspection rather than a quick tune-up. Battery pack is in the side pouch, charger included. Once Fenwick Aerials signs off on the repair, it goes straight back out by courier. The hand-over instruction for the courier is below.

handover note for yagef-bagep: the drudor pelius courier leaves the kasdor zorvan norir ledger at gate 8016 under passcode 755406